Principal Engineer HWSW for Medium Voltage Motor Drives (fmdiv)
Your role
Key responsibilities in your new role
-
Assume a role of Product Definition and Product Application Engineers with a strong focus on Motor drives and BMS systems
-
Develop and support motor drives applications with focus on MOSFETs (48VDC-400VDC) for various industries, such as robotics, drones, power tools and other applications primarily in GC but also in AP region
-
Drive and support the Product Line (PL) strategy, enabling growth and securing design wins in the Drives and BMS segment
-
Act as the key interface in the region and communicate with headquarters , ensuring clear communication of objectives, priorities, and responsibilities
-
Lead junior engineers in the region and foster collaboration and alignment across different locations
-
Represent the team and product line in industry conferences, customer engagements, and technical forums
-
Execute the PL strategy with a strong focus on expanding presence and capability in the Asia region
-
Serve as a direct technical and strategic interface with key customers, supporting critical engagements and business development activities
-
Define and drive a global lab support strategy, ensuring effective collaboration and knowledge exchange across regions
-
Drive technical Go-to-Market activities, including bench measurements, creating digital content, publishing papers and documents, perform system simulations to secure design-win.
-
Provide 2nd level technical support to field application engineers and customers on application level with system simulations, and hardware builds
Your profile
Qualifications and skills to help you succeed
University degree in Electrical Engineering, Power Electronics, or a related field (M.Sc. or PhD preferred)-
8+ years of experience in power electronics, with at least 2 years in a leadership or senior technical role and solid expertise in Motor drives and BMS topologies, power MOSFETs, and system-level power design
-
Experience in product definition, application engineering, or system architecture within the semiconductor industry
-
Hands-on experience in customer-facing roles, ensuring business win.
-
Exposure to cross-regional collaboration and global project execution.
-
Ability to lead cross-regional teams and work effectively across cultures, including exposure to Asia markets
-
In depth understanding of medium voltage MOSFETs (80-400V)
-
Willingness to travel
